Li'l Quinquin - 4/5

In rural Northern France, a bumbling cop and his partner investigate a bizarre murder in which a body that's been hacked to pieces is found inside of a cow. While interviewing the colorful locals they constantly cross paths with a foul-mouthed racist juvenile delinquent whose father might be hiding some dark secrets. Good black comedy from Bruno Dumont about the nature of evil that resides within us all.

Return - 3.5/5

A soldier experiences hardship in readjusting to being a mother and wife after returning home from combat. Good film about the irreversible psychological damage of war that's well acted by Linda Cardinelli and Michael Shannon.

Bridgend - 4/5

Grim documentary about a county in South Wales where within a span of 5 years there have been 79 suicides by hanging in which the majority were teen-agers who knew each other. Speculations have been made about a suicide cult, devil worshipping or a serial killer but no proof has ever been found. Sad and creepy.

The Nightmare - 3.5/5

A documentary that re-enacts people's experiences while under sleep paralysis. Focuses on the scary accounts of those who have experienced the condition while skipping the science, which makes it feels like an anthology of horror shorts.

Rubble Kings - 3.5/5

Documentary about the urban decay of the 1970's South Bronx and how poverty caused the emergence of the gangs that ran the streets. As someone who grew up in 1970's NYC I was really into this. At a little over an hour, I wish it could have been longer and gone into more detail.

Después de Lucía (After Lucía) - 4/5

After the death of her mother, a teen-ager and her father move to a new city. As the new girl in school her daily life becomes a living hell of bullying and humiliation. A well made hard hitting realistic film that is sometimes difficult to watch. Good to see talent coming from Mexico that's just as good, if not better, than the three guys who now work for Hollywood.

Birth of the Living Dead - 4/5

Documentary about George Romero's Night of the Living Dead. The ideas that influenced it, the making of it and its impact on film. If you're a fan of the film and its director, this is a must watch.
